微波EDA网,见证研发工程师的成长!
首页 > 研发问答 > 嵌入式设计讨论 > MCU和单片机设计讨论 > 单片机程序简化问题

单片机程序简化问题

时间:10-02 整理:3721RD 点击:
请问单片机的程序简化应该从哪些方面入手,才可以使单片机的运行速度加快?

优秀的算法,加上你所用的语言(比如说汇编的执行效率就相对比c等高级语言快)

我的程序没什么高深算法,用的是C语言,有没有其他办法优化啊,例如哪些东西是可以不用的?

亲,我也没看过你的具体的程序,具体什么东西可以不用,谁都不好说,所以只能泛泛而谈,我不是说你的程序有没有高深的算法,我是说,同样实现一个功能,好的算法可能几句换就实现了,如果你的工程很庞大,的确急需优化,但是如果你的程序不是很大,我建议你买一本算法方面的书看,还有就是多看别人写得好的程序,看多了,写多了,自己都可以慢慢优化了

把用不到的程序删掉,其实也提高不了多少效率。只是多占了些代码空间而已,因为不用的程序,根本不会运行到里面去。
提高运行效率,只能优化运算。

好的,谢谢啊!问题已经解决!

上一篇:单片机测距遇到问题
下一篇:7816协议

Copyright © 2017-2020 微波EDA网 版权所有

网站地图

Top